About ZIP Code 33615

ZIP code 33615 is located in Tampa, Florida, within Hillsborough County. With a population of 48,122, this is a highly populated ZIP code with a middle-aged community — the median age is 39.1 years. Economically, 33615 is a solidly middle-class ZIP code: the median household income of $66,257 is near the national average.

Real estate in ZIP code 33615 represents a mid-range housing market. The median home value of $291,500 is near the national average. Renters can expect to pay around $1,586 per month in median rent. The area has a relatively balanced mix of owners (55.8%) and renters (44.2%). Median home values have increased by 75% since 2019.

The population of 33615 is majority Hispanic (55.96%). Residents are well-educated — 42.8% hold a bachelor's degree or higher, which is near the national average. Poverty affects some residents at 13.6%. Household income has grown by 28% since 2019.

The unemployment rate in 33615 stands at 5.2%, which is near the national average. About 15% of workers are remote. As in most parts of the country, driving alone is the dominant commute mode at 73%.

Overall, ZIP code 33615 in Tampa, FL is characterized as solidly middle-class, well-educated, and a middle-aged community. With 48,122 residents, a median household income of $66,257, and a median home value of $291,500, it offers a clear picture of life in this part of Florida.
